Thanks, Gil -- the new timetable, however, still shows the old Empire Builder schedule. In addition, it still shows the Blue Water leaving East Lansing (westbound)at 8:45 AM. I got an e-mail from AMTRAK in the last week or so and new e-tickets, which state that the Blue Water now leaves East Lansing at 7:45 AM. I will be starting my trip on June 12, and that will be my first train.
